John Samuel Kenyon

Summary

John Samuel Kenyon is a human[1]. He was born in Medina[2]. He was born on +1874-07-26T00:00:00Z[3]. He died on +1959-09-06T00:00:00Z[4]. He worked as a linguist[5], philologist[6], and university teacher[7]. He ranks in the top 0.73%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(5 views/month, #7,296 of 1,000,298).[8]
